What does "tinker" mean?
-
noun A traveling mender of pots, pans, and other metal household items.
"The old tinker went from village to village fixing kettles."
-
verb To fiddle or experiment with something in an amateur, exploratory way, trying to fix or improve it.
"He spent Sunday afternoon tinkering with the old motorbike."
tinker in a sentence
- The old tinker went from village to village fixing kettles.
- Her grandfather worked as a tinker before the factories took over.
- He spent Sunday afternoon tinkering with the old motorbike.
- Don't tinker with the settings unless you know what you're doing.
